Dude, all of that is well known by the experts and many laymen.

Natural processes have been going on since the beginning of time, yet CO2 levels are higher than they've been in 400,000 years.  As carbon is emitted, it is also absorbed by natural processes.  Since the industrial revolution (especially the last 50 years), the CO2 released into the atmosphere has resulted in a significant increase in concentration of CO2 in the atmosphere because the absorption processes are not keeping up with the emissions.

MIT’s Richard Lindzen, the unalarmed climate scientist


Quote:

When you first meet Richard Lindzen, the Alfred P. Sloan professor of meteorology at MIT, senior fellow at the Cato Institute, leading climate “skeptic,” and all-around scourge of James Hansen, Bill McKibben, Al Gore, the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C), and sundry other climate “alarmists,” as Lindzen calls them, you may find yourself a bit surprised.





Quote:

Where Lindzen hasn’t remained is in the mainstream of his discipline. By the 1980s, global warming was becoming a major political issue. Already, Lindzen was having doubts about the more catastrophic predictions being made. The public rollout of the “alarmist” case, he notes, “was immediately accompanied by an issue of Newsweek declaring all scientists agreed. And that was the beginning of a ‘consensus’ argument. Already by ’88 the New York Times had literally a global warming beat.” Lindzen wasn’t buying it. Nonetheless, he remained in the good graces of mainstream climate science, and in the early 1990s, he was invited to join the IPCC, a U.N.-backed multinational consortium of scientists charged with synthesizing and analyzing the current state of the world’s climate science. Lindzen accepted, and he ended up as a contributor to the 1995 report and the lead author of Chapter 7 (“Physical Climate Processes and Feedbacks”) of the 2001 report. Since then, however, he’s grown increasingly distant from prevalent (he would say “hysterical”) climate science, and he is voluminously on record disputing the predictions of catastrophe.





Quote:

But Lindzen rejects the dire projections. For one thing, he says that the Summary for Policymakers is an inherently problematic document. The IPCC report itself, weighing in at thousands of pages, is “not terrible. It’s not unbiased, but the bias [is] more or less to limit your criticism of models,” he says. The Summary for Policymakers, on the other hand—the only part of the report that the media and the politicians pay any attention to—“rips out doubts to a large extent. .  .  . [Furthermore], government representatives have the final say on the summary.” Thus, while the full IPPC report demonstrates a significant amount of doubt among scientists, the essentially political Summary for Policymakers filters it out.

I noticed in this thread a little misconception. That climate change = global warming. I studied Environmental Engineering is college and a big chunk of a few of my classes went towards studying climate change. I had the opportunity to have access to several college studies from varying schools across the country when doing to research. Sadly I can't really access those anymore because it was on the school networks.

Anyways to sum it all up. what has been observed in the last 100 years is that the high and lows of our weather extremes are getting farther apart. During the first half of the century up to the 1970's the overall climate was fairly predictable and stable. Now we are having some years with several feet of snow and the next year its barely snowing. This rate of average increase and the variance from year to year is VERY uncommon in earths history judging from ice core samples they have been researching for the last 100 years. So overall the global climate is changing very rapidly.

The leading explanation is the increase in green house gases that help to generate just slight increase in overall global temperature avg. Its not much but in polar regions where just a little bit warmer means thousands of miles of ice melting this causes fresh water to pour into the ocean disrupting major ocean currents that help facilitate overall global patterns. Which in turn effect the speed and location of the jet streams around the world (polar vortex anyone).

People have spent their entire careers researching this. It is scientifically sound and can be explained using the laws of thermodynamics.

The leading contributing factors to green house gases is livestock farming, industry/power, cars, then natural processes (includes forest decay and volcanoes). I believe that's in order if I remember correctly.
